Ownership vs. Chartering: The Initial Choice
Step one in estimating the cost of private jet travel is deciding whether or not to purchase a jet or charter one. Each option comes with its own financial implications.
Ownership Prices: Owning a private jet might be a big funding, with prices starting from a couple of million dollars for smaller aircraft to over $one hundred million for larger, long-vary jets. Past the acquisition price, house owners must also consider ongoing bills corresponding to maintenance, insurance coverage, crew salaries, hangar fees, and fuel. The annual costs for ownership can simply attain a whole bunch of hundreds to tens of millions of dollars, relying on the aircraft type and usage.
Chartering Prices: For individuals who do not fly often enough to justify ownership, chartering is a viable alternative. Charter prices are usually calculated based mostly on hourly rates, which may vary significantly depending on the aircraft type, distance, and additional services. On common, chartering a private jet can value anywhere from $1,200 to $8,000 per flight hour. This value often contains the aircraft, crew, and basic amenities, however further prices might apply for particular requests or companies.
Factors Influencing Private Jet Estimates
Several key components influence the general price of private jet travel, whether or not proudly owning or chartering. Understanding these factors may help potential customers higher estimate their bills.
- Aircraft Sort: The type of aircraft performs a important role in determining costs. Gentle jets, which seat 4-6 passengers, are usually the most affordable, whereas mid-measurement and heavy jets can value significantly more. As an example, a mild jet like a Cessna Quotation might price round $2,500 per hour to charter, while a heavy jet like a Bombardier Global 6000 can exceed $8,000 per hour.
- Flight Distance: The distance of the flight is another crucial issue. Longer flights require more fuel and time, which will increase the overall price. Moreover, longer trips could necessitate extra extended crew hours, further including to the expense.
- Flight Duration: Similar to distance, the duration of the flight affects the price. Charter companies usually cost by the hour, so longer flights will naturally incur greater prices. Moreover, if the flight requires overnight stays for the crew, it will also be reflected in the final invoice.
- Airport Charges: Private jets typically incur landing, takeoff, and parking charges at airports. These fees can fluctuate broadly depending on the airport's location and dimension. Major worldwide airports might cost larger charges in comparison with smaller regional airports. Moreover, some airports may have fixed-base operators (FBOs) that cost for providers corresponding to fueling, hangaring, and floor transportation.
- Gas Prices: Gasoline prices fluctuate primarily based on market conditions and can significantly influence operational costs. Jet gasoline costs can differ by location and are often greater at airports with limited competitors. Homeowners and charter corporations should think about these prices when estimating general expenses.
- Crew Prices: For house owners, crew salaries and advantages are a considerable ongoing expense. Charter companies sometimes include crew costs in their hourly rates, but additional expenses could apply for prolonged flights that require crew layovers or extra workers.
- Maintenance and Insurance: For aircraft homeowners, common upkeep is essential to ensure safety and compliance with aviation laws. Maintenance costs can differ depending on the aircraft's age and utilization. Additionally, insurance prices must be factored into the overall expense, as they are often substantial for top 5 private jet charter companies-worth aircraft.
- Amenities and Services: The extent of luxury and amenities supplied may affect prices. Some jets come outfitted with excessive-end options reminiscent of gourmet catering, in-flight leisure methods, and luxurious seating. Customizing these services can add to the overall expense, whether or not proudly owning or chartering.
Additional Prices to think about
Along with the first costs associated with private jet travel, several other bills could arise:
- Catering: Whereas some charter firms embody basic catering of their fees, extra elaborate meal options can incur extra fees. Owners might also need to finances for catering services when flying their jets.
- Floor Transportation: Arranging floor transportation to and from the airport can add to the general value. Limousines, automotive rentals, or shuttle services may be needed, depending on the traveler's preferences.
- De-icing Companies: In colder climates, de-icing companies may be needed earlier than departure, which may result in extra fees.
- In a single day Charges: If the aircraft just isn't returning to its residence base after a trip, in a single day charges for parking and crew accommodations may apply.
